strman.equal 是一款适用于 JavaScript 的 NPM 包,它提供了一个快速比较两个字符串是否相等的方法。对于前端开发人员来说,这是非常必要的,因为在开发中,往往需要进行字符串的比较操作。本文将为大家详细介绍 npm 包 strman.equal 的使用教程,并提供示例代码和学习指导。
基础介绍
strman.equal 的官方介绍如下:
-- -------------------- ---- ------- --- - --------- - ---------- ------ - ------ ------------ - - ------------ ------- -- --- ------- --- --- ----- - - ------ -------- ----- --- ----- ------ -- -------- - ------ -------- ------ --- ------ ------ -- -------- - ------ --------- -------------------- -- - ---- --------- ------------ ------- ----- - - -------- --------- - ------- ---------- -- --- --- ------- --- ------ -- ---- - - -------- - -------------------------- ------------- - -- -- ----- - - -------- - -------------------------- ------------- ------ - -- -- ---- --
在上述官方介绍中,我们看到了 strman.equal 的基础介绍,它提供了两个字符串作为参数,用于比较这两个字符串是否相等,同时还可以通过第三个参数来指定是否进行大小写敏感的比较。官方介绍还提供了一个示例,展示了该包的基本用法。
安装和导入
在使用 strman.equal 进行字符串比较之前,需要安装该包并导入到你的项目中。可以使用以下命令进行安装:
npm install strman.equal
在安装完成之后,可以使用以下代码将该包导入到你的项目中:
const strman = require('strman.equal');
使用上述代码载入 strman.equal 后,您就可以开始使用它进行字符串的比较操作。
API 使用
strman.equal 的使用非常简单,您只需要调用该方法并传入要比较的两个字符串即可。例如:
const strman = require('strman.equal'); const result = strman.equal('hello', 'HELLO'); console.log(result); // 输出为 false,因为默认情况下进行大小写敏感的比较
在上述代码中,我们调用了 strman.equal 方法,并传入了两个字符串 "hello" 和 "HELLO"。因为默认情况下进行大小写敏感的比较,所以该方法返回值为 false。
如果您需要进行大小写不敏感的字符串比较,可以使用以下代码:
const strman = require('strman.equal'); const result = strman.equal('hello', 'HELLO', false); console.log(result); // 输出为 true,因为进行了大小写不敏感的比较
代码中的第三个参数为 false,表示进行大小写不敏感的字符串比较。此时,该方法返回值为 true。
示例代码
在本节中,我们提供两个示例代码,供读者参考 strman.equal 的使用。
示例 1:
const strman = require('strman.equal'); const result1 = strman.equal('hello', 'HELLO'); const result2 = strman.equal('hello', 'HELLO', false); console.log(result1); // 输出为 false console.log(result2); // 输出为 true
示例 2:
-- -------------------- ---- ------- ----- ------ - ------------------------ ----- ----- - --------- -------- -------- --------- ----- ------------- - --- --- ---- - - -- - - ------------- ---- - -- ----------------------- --------- - ----------------------------- - - --------------------------- -- --- --------- --------
在该示例中,我们创建了一个字符串数组 words,并用 for 循环遍历该数组,用 strman.equal 方法检查每个字符串是否与 "hello" 相等,如果匹配,就添加到 filteredWords 数组中。
学习指导
在本节中,我们提供一些学习指导,帮助大家进一步了解 strman.equal 包的使用。
文档阅读
在您使用包之前,需要先阅读该包的官方文档,了解该包提供了哪些方法和参数。在了解了官方文档之后,您可以更好地使用该包。
尝试示例代码
本文提供了多个示例代码来介绍 strman.equal 包的使用。您可以将这些示例代码复制到您的本地开发环境中,应用到您的项目中进行实验。
尝试不同的参数组合
strman.equal 提供了多个参数,您可以尝试使用不同的参数组合来比较字符串。这将有助于您更好地理解该包的工作原理。
实践使用场景
在您深入了解了这个包的使用之后,可以思考在实际项目中如何使用该包。您可以探索各种情况下该包的使用,以及如何与其他工具和技术组合使用。
结论
npm 包 strman.equal 是一个非常有用的工具,它提供了一个快速比较两个字符串是否相等的方法。在本文中,我们详细介绍了该包的使用教程和示例代码,并提供了学习指导。在您了解了该包之后,我们建议您多尝试使用该包,深入探索其使用场景和用例。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600556fc81e8991b448d3e36